Got a chance to go back to Beaver on Saturday. There were lots of boats out, but we caught a break and never really dealt with any traffic. Caught 30, with 28 of them smallies. No big ones but we had a great time. WT 66.5 in the morning to 69 when we left around 12:30. Caught a couple nicer ones (2.2-2.4lbs) that had not spawned yet. Ned and the short jerk bait. Tried top water and kept an eye out for top water action all morning to no avail. Had them push/slap a top water a few times but never hooked up. I’d say 9-10ft was our shallow water for the day, out to 16-18. Didn’t seem to have much luck shallower or deeper. 
 

Before the trip, got the house/cranking battery replaced. Ended up going with a Millertech 190ah lithium. Replacing the charger turned into another unforeseen project, as the 3-bank Millertech charger is literally 1/4” too tall to fit on the reinforced plate where the factory charger is installed on the Phoenix. It’s a big ole charger. I measured before I bought, but didn’t think about the dimensions of the actual mounting geometry. So, I had to fab up some 1/4” aluminum stock to give me good mounting surface.
